IMPROVING STUDENTS’ READING COMPREHENSION THROUGH LISTEN–READ–DISCUSS (LRD) STRATEGY AT MA NURUSSABAH PRAYA TENGAH Terasne Terasne; Nanang Sugianto; Abdul Wahab; Maria Ulfa

Abstract

This research was aimed at describe whether listen-read-discuss (LRD) strategy be able to improve students’ reading comprehension or not. It was a classroom action research. The data collected uses quantitative and qualitative data. Quantitative data was gained from the result of pre-test and post-test from reading test. Meanwhile, qualitative data was gained from the result of observation sheets toward students and teachers activity. The instrument uses were test and observation sheet. The result shows that the strategy be able to improve the students’ reading comprehension in report text. The improvement can be seen from the mean score of students from pre-test, post-test one, and post-test two. The mean score of pre-test was 69.5 (35%), there were seven students who passed the minimum passing grade, in the post-test one, 72.2 (60%), twelve students passed the minimum passing grade and in the post-test two, 78.25 (85%),  seventeen students passed the minimum passing grade (KKM).
ERROR ANALYSIS IN USING “GOING TO” AND “WILL” IN SENTENCES; AT MA NW MISPALAH CENTRAL LOMBOK IN ACADEMIC YEAR 2013/2014 Terasne Terasne; Nanang Sugianto

Abstract

The research entitled “Error analysis in using “going to” and” will” in sentences; at Ma NW Mispalah  Central Lombok in academic year 2013/2014” is aimed to find out the errors that students make in using going to and will in sentences.  The sample of this research is all of the students at MA NW Mispalah Central Lombok that consists of one class with the total 51 students. Collecting the data of the study, the researcher uses grammar test as the main instrument which was distributed to the whole samples. The four steps; identification, classification, description and explanation were used to analyzed the data in this study. The conclusion of the study concluded that the errors that students made are categorized into omissions errors, addition errors and miss-formation errors. Students omitted the “going to” and “will”, copulas and auxiliaries which must appear in the well-formed English sentences, they added going to and will and copulas which must not appear in the well-formed English sentences, they miss-formation the going to and will, copulas and auxiliaries by using the wrong forms of morphemes or structures, they also made the incorrect placement of verbs, adverbs and objects or complements of the sentences. The total percentage of miss-formation error categories, the writer found that the most likely committed by the students is miss-formation of going to and will. From 7, 2 % of miss-formation categories, about 2, 9 % are miss-formation of  “going to” and “will”.
THE EFFECTIVENESS OF USING PREVIEW, QUESTION, READ, REFLECT, RECITE AND REVIEW (PQ4R) TOWARD STUDENTS’ CRITICAL THINKING ABILITY ON READING COMPREHENSION Terasne Terasne; Nanang Sugianto

Abstract

This research was aimed at knowing the effectiveness of using Preview, Question, Read, Reflect, Recite and Review or PQ4R toward Students’ Critical Thinking Ability on Reading Comprehension at Second Grade Students at SMAN 1 Batulayar in Academic Year 2017/2018. This research was an experimental research and the design was quasi-experimental nonequivalent design pre-test post-test design. The sample all of students at Second Grade and the total number was 24 students in which consisted of two classes. Where II-A consisted of 12 students and II-B consisted of 12 students. The class divided into two groups, namely experimental group and Control group. The data was collected by using pre-test and pos-test. The instrument of this research used was reading test inform of multiple choice test. The technique that used to analysis the data was t-test formula. From the data analysis, it found that the result of t-test (1.41) was lower than t-table (1.714). The mean score of experimental group in post-test was (19.16) and the mean score of pre-test was (7.08). Based on the result of the research, it can be concluded that the used of PQ4R has not effective toward Students’ Critical Thinking Ability on Reading Comprehension at Second Grade Students of SMAN 1 Batu Layar in Academic Year 2018/2019.
THE EFFECTIVENESS OF USING WORD MAP TECHNIQUE IN TEACHING VOCABULARY AT THIRD GRADE STUDENTS OF IKIP MATARAM IN ACADEMIC YEAR 2015/2016 Terasne Terasne

Abstract

This research aims to find out the effectiveness of using “Word Map” Technique in teaching vocabulary at third grades students of IKIP Mataram in academic year 2015/2016?”. This was a quasi experimental research. The sample of this research was two classes, they were A class and B class in which consist of 39 students. It takes by using cluster random sampling. The sample of the research divided into two groups namely experimental group and control group. Experimental group was taught by Word Map Technique and control group was taught by Three Phase Technique. The design of the research as follow: Pre-test, Treatment, and Posttest.The instrument was multiple choices test consist of 25 items for right answers was  4 for each item. Then, for all right answer ranged 100 for the highest and for the lowest was 0. Based on the data analysis it was found that t-test score was 7.743 and t-table was 1.668. The result showed that the value of t-test was highest then the value of t-table. So, it conclude that there was significant effect of Word Map Technique in teaching vocabulary at third grades students of IKIP Mataram in academic year 2015/2016.
